Transaction f50146880eabe86273c5df58ed49c180f03a2693c5c6eb5f57209de0a9424045
1 Input
2 Outputs
- f50146880eabe86273c5df58ed49c180f03a2693c5c6eb5f57209de0a9424045:0
- f50146880eabe86273c5df58ed49c180f03a2693c5c6eb5f57209de0a9424045:1
value 21422
address 16bKt4Qg1LLCxgegyuVvyKdBTXuojz15Uf
value 41700429
address 17FGSzf2ZRX6QLaVA4kcRTwM4LG35qmzdc